Abstract

The quadrupole interaction frequencyv q =eQV zz /h = 8.92(9) MHz was observed for the 75 keV state of100Rh in a polycrystalline beryllium matrix by use of the e-γ time differential perturbed angular correlation technique. The measured spin rotation pattern is hardly disturbed in spite of the fact that the source was produced by an isotope separator implantation of100Pd into a beryllium foil without any after-treatment.
